.elementor-77 .elementor-element.elementor-element-bd1b47c:not(.elementor-motion-effects-element-type-background),
.elementor-77 .elementor-element.elementor-element-bd1b47c>.elementor-motion-effects-container>.elementor-motion-effects-layer {
    background-image: url("../css/images/banner-img.png");
}

.elementor-77 .elementor-element.elementor-element-bd1b47c {
    trans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
    margin-top: -100px;
    margin-bottom: 0px;
    padding: 0px 0px 0px 0px;
}

.elementor-77 .elementor-element.elementor-element-bd1b47c>.elementor-background-overlay {
    trans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}

.elementor-77 .elementor-element.elementor-element-4d916c7 {
    margin-top: -95px;
    margin-bottom: 0px;
    padding: 0px 0px 0px 0px;
}

.elementor-77 .elementor-element.elementor-element-5b69dca {
    margin-top: -94px;
    margin-bottom: 20px;
    padding: 0px 0px 0px 0px;
}

.elementor-77 .elementor-element.elementor-element-2236ed5:not(.elementor-motion-effects-element-type-background),
.elementor-77 .elementor-element.elementor-element-2236ed5>.elementor-motion-effects-container>.elementor-motion-effects-layer {
    background-color: #e8f6ff;
}

.elementor-77 .elementor-element.elementor-element-2236ed5 {
    trans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
}

.elementor-77 .elementor-element.elementor-element-2236ed5>.elementor-background-overlay {
    trans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}

.elementor-77 .elementor-element.elementor-element-aaffff7 {
    padding: 80px 0px 0px 0px;
}

.elementor-77 .elementor-element.elementor-element-04d6e97 {
    trans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
}

.elementor-77 .elementor-element.elementor-element-04d6e97>.elementor-background-overlay {
    trans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}

.elementor-77 .elementor-element.elementor-element-59d3be7 {
    padding: 0px 0px 100px 0px;
}

.elementor-77 .elementor-element.elementor-element-c695ad2:not(.elementor-motion-effects-element-type-background),
.elementor-77 .elementor-element.elementor-element-c695ad2>.elementor-motion-effects-container>.elementor-motion-effects-layer {
    background-color: #e8f6ff;
}

.elementor-77 .elementor-element.elementor-element-c695ad2 {
    transition: background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;
    margin-top: 0px;
    margin-bottom: -100px;
    padding: 60px 0px 100px 0px;
}

.elementor-77 .elementor-element.elementor-element-c695ad2>.elementor-background-overlay {
    transition: background 0.3s, border-radius 0.3s, opacity 0.3s;
}